Japanese high school students' usage of mobile phones while cycling.

作者信息

Ichikawa Masao, Nakahara Shinji

机构信息

Department of Community Health, School of International Health, University of Tokyo, Tokyo, Japan.

出版信息

Traffic Inj Prev. 2008 Mar;9(1):42-7. doi: 10.1080/15389580701718389.

Abstract

OBJECTIVE

To investigate the perception and actual use of mobile phones among Japanese high school students while riding their bicycles, and their experience of bicycle crash/near-crash.

METHODS

A questionnaire survey was carried out at high schools that were, at the time of the survey, commissioned by the National Agency for the Advancement of Sports and Health to conduct school safety research.

RESULTS

In the survey, we found that mobile phone use while riding a bicycle was quite common among the students during their commute, but those who have a higher perception of danger in this practice, and those who perceived that this practice is prohibited, were less likely to engage in this practice. Male students and students commuting to school by bicycle only were more likely to have used phones while riding. There was a significant relationship between phone usage while riding a bicycle and the experience of bicycle crash/near-crash, although its causality was not established. Bicycle crash/near-crash experienced while using a phone was less prevalent among the students who had a higher perception of danger in phone usage while riding, students who perceived that this practice is prohibited, and students with a shorter travel time by bicycle during the commute.

CONCLUSIONS

Since mobile phone use while riding a bicycle potentially increases crash risk among cyclists, student bicycle commuters should be made aware of this risk. Moreover, they should be informed that cyclists' phone usage while riding is prohibited according to the road traffic law.

摘要

目的

调查日本高中生骑自行车时对手机的认知与实际使用情况,以及他们遭遇自行车碰撞/险些碰撞的经历。

方法

在调查时受国家体育与健康促进机构委托开展学校安全研究的高中进行了问卷调查。

结果

在调查中,我们发现学生在通勤时骑自行车使用手机的情况相当普遍,但那些对这种行为危险认知较高的学生,以及那些认为这种行为被禁止的学生,较少会这样做。男生以及仅骑自行车上学的学生在骑车时更有可能使用手机。骑自行车时使用手机与自行车碰撞/险些碰撞的经历之间存在显著关系,尽管其因果关系尚未确立。在骑车时使用手机时遭遇自行车碰撞/险些碰撞的情况,在那些对骑车时使用手机危险认知较高的学生、认为这种行为被禁止的学生以及通勤时骑自行车出行时间较短的学生中不太普遍。

结论

由于骑自行车时使用手机可能会增加骑车者发生碰撞的风险,学生自行车通勤者应意识到这种风险。此外,应告知他们根据道路交通法,骑车时使用手机是被禁止的。
